1. Understand the Market Dynamics
The real estate market in Westlake, TX, is dynamic and can shift between a buyer's and a seller's market swiftly. Being cognizant of the current market conditions is crucial. In a seller’s market, multiple offers are common due to high demand and low inventory. Knowing this helps set realistic expectations and prepares you for quick decision-making.
2. Prepare for Multiple Scenarios
Before listing a home in Westlake, TX, it's prudent to discuss potential scenarios with your real estate agent, including the possibility of receiving multiple offers. Preparation involves understanding the various terms and conditions that can come with different offers, such as contingencies, closing times, and financing options. This preparation ensures you won’t be making decisions under pressure, which could lead to less favorable outcomes.
3. Set a Deadline for Offers
When it becomes apparent that your listing might attract multiple offers, setting a deadline can help manage the situation more effectively. This not only streamlines the process by consolidating the offers to review at one time but also signals to buyers that your property is in demand, potentially encouraging more competitive terms.
4. Review All Offers Carefully
Each offer must be evaluated not only based on the purchase price but also on the terms included. Factors such as the buyer's financing, the presence of contingencies, proposed closing dates, and even the earnest money deposit can affect the attractiveness of an offer. Sellers should look at the entirety of each offer to determine which one truly aligns best with their needs.
5. Leverage Counteroffers Strategically
In situations with multiple offers, leverage is a powerful tool. You may choose to counter one offer while keeping others in a backup position. This strategy can be used to negotiate better terms, even if the initial price is competitive. It's important to communicate clearly and promptly with all potential buyers through your agent to maintain interest and momentum.
6. Focus on Your Buyers’ Qualifications
Higher offers are enticing, but it’s essential to consider the buyer's ability to close the deal. A well-qualified buyer with a pre-approval letter from a reputable lender often presents a safer bet than a higher offer from someone with questionable financial stability. This consideration is crucial in Westlake, TX, homes for sale, where market fluctuations can affect buyer financing.
7. Maintain Transparency with All Parties
Transparency is key in handling multiple offers ethically. Ensure that all parties are aware of the situation and understand how you will proceed with the offer review process. This approach not only builds trust but also maintains a positive reputation in the real estate community.
8. Don't Rush Your Decision
While it may be tempting to accept the highest offer immediately, take the time to consider all aspects of each proposal. Discuss with your agent the pros and cons of each offer based on your specific priorities, whether they be a higher price, quicker closing, or fewer contingencies.
9. Keep Your Emotions in Check
The excitement of receiving multiple offers can be overwhelming, but it’s important to stay objective. Decisions driven by emotion rather than rational consideration can lead to complications later in the transaction.
